Boolambayte, NSW 2423

Part of: Mid-Coast Council No data available

The size of Boolambayte is approximately 89.8 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 72.5% of total area. The population of Boolambayte in 2016 was 87 people. By 2021 the population was 85 showing a population decline of 2.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Boolambayte is 50-59 years. Households in Boolambayte are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Boolambayte work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 82.40% of the homes in Boolambayte were owner-occupied compared with 97.40% in 2016. (source: Australian Bureau of Statistics)
